Tuesday morning's light snowfall in the valley meant a busy morning for Nevada Highway Patrol troopers. 

NHP tells us it received the most calls for help on U.S. 395 between North McCarran and the Cold Springs interchanges. 

In just three hours, nine calls involving accidents and over a dozen spin outs and slide offs were called in for this 10-mile stretch. 

NHP says eight of those accidents were non-injury, largely single-vehicle collisions where the driver lost control. There was also a three-vehicle crash around 6 a.m. Tuesday near the Panther Valley interchange. Again, no one was hurt. 

There was only one accident with minor injuries – involving a rollover near the southbound Red Rock exit. A child inside suffered minor injuries and was treated at the scene.
